Replying to: ivorypearlg (May 21, 2006 9:02 am) Seems like this person invented the jet turbine in the 1920's/1930's. The use of turbos in cars is just another adaption of outside technology being brought into the automotive world. http://www.cwn.org.uk/heritage/people/whittle/biography.html But turbochargers in and of themselves have been on engines since the 1920s. http://www.turbolader.net/en/content/history_turbocharger.htm |
